Klea Blackhurst takes on an infamously cut song from Jerry Herman's Hello, Dolly! in a new video released from her concert One of the Girls. Blackhurst is performing the Jerry Herman-themed evening again February 16, at Chelsea Table + Stage, part of her ongoing career retrospective series The Box Set. Watch Blackhurst sing "World Take Me Back" above.

The song is one of two tunes written for the musical's original intended star, Ethel Merman. Designed for Merman's distinctive belt, both "World Take Me Back" and "Love, Look In My Window" were deleted from the score when Merman turned the show down, with the role famously going to Carol Channing. When Merman did ultimately play the role, the final replacement during the original Broadway run, both songs were inserted back into the score, a Broadway rarity.

Blackhurst's upcoming Chelsea Table + Stage shows also include Autumn in New York: Vernon Duke’s Broadway (April 13); A Brand New Evening with Klea Blackhurst (May 18); Dreaming of a Song: The Music of Hoagy Carmichael, featuring Billy Stritch (October 19); and Everything the Traffic Will Allow: The Songs and Sass of Ethel Merman (November 16).

A streaming option is also available for all shows.

Blackhurst's recent theatrical credits include the Witch in Into the Woods for Opera North; Ragtime: The Symphonic Concert with the Boston Pops at Tanglewood, conducted by Keith Lockhart; and Ragtime: The Symphonic Concert with the Cincinnati Pops, under the direction of John Morris Russell.
